基础护理学

Fundamentals of Nursing

课程介绍 Course Introduction

学分:5 | 先修课:解剖学、生理学 | 学期:第二学期

本课程是护理学专业的核心入门课程,系统介绍护理学的基本概念、理论框架和临床基本操作技能。内容包括护理程序、健康与疾病、医院环境、入院与出院护理、舒适与安全、清洁卫生、生命体征评估与护理、冷热疗法、饮食与营养、排泄护理、给药护理、静脉输液与输血、标本采集、病情观察与危重病抢救等。

This core introductory course systematically introduces the basic concepts, theoretical frameworks, and fundamental clinical skills of nursing. Topics include the nursing process, health and illness, hospital environment, admission and discharge care, comfort and safety, hygiene, vital signs assessment and care, heat and cold therapy, diet and nutrition, elimination care, medication administration, IV therapy and blood transfusion, specimen collection, and emergency care.

大作业 Final Project

作业标题:患者护理评估与护理计划制定

选择一个临床病例,进行系统护理评估,提出护理诊断并制定完整护理计划,实施护理措施并评价效果。提交护理病历。

Select a clinical case, conduct a systematic nursing assessment, identify nursing diagnoses, develop a complete care plan, implement nursing interventions, and evaluate outcomes. Submit a nursing record.

实施步骤 Implementation Steps

示例:为一个具体患者制定护理计划,比如一位刚做完心脏手术的老年患者。你需要评估他的术后状况(疼痛、活动能力、心理状态),设计个性化的护理措施(疼痛管理、早期活动、心理支持),然后跟踪护理效果并调整方案。
步骤 1
病例选择与护理评估框架设计
本步骤的核心任务是选择一个具有代表性的临床病例,设计系统的护理评估框架。病例选择需要涵盖多个系统的健康问题,能够体现护理程序的完整应用。护理评估是护理程序的第一步,也是最关键的一步,全面、准确的评估是正确护理诊断和有效护理措施的基础。

• 选择典型病例:从内科、外科、老年科或社区护理中选择一个具有多个护理问题的病例(如老年高血压合并糖尿病患者、术后恢复期患者、慢性阻塞性肺疾病患者),获取完整的病史和检查资料
• 设计护理评估框架:按照Gordon功能健康形态或NANDA护理诊断框架,设计涵盖11个功能领域的评估内容,包括一般资料、现病史、既往史、身体评估、心理社会评估、实验室检查等
• 制定评估计划:确定评估方法(交谈、观察、身体检查、查阅病历)、评估工具(量表如疼痛量表、焦虑量表、压疮风险评估表、跌倒风险评估表)和评估时间安排
产出:病例摘要、护理评估框架表、评估工具清单、评估实施计划| 质量标准:病例典型复杂适当,评估框架系统全面,工具选择科学合理
步骤 2
系统护理评估与数据收集
本步骤的核心任务是按照护理评估框架进行系统、全面的护理评估,收集主观和客观资料。评估过程需要运用沟通技巧获取患者信任,运用身体评估技能获得准确的体征数据,运用评判性思维识别异常发现。完整、准确的评估数据是整个护理程序的基石。

• 进行护理交谈与健康史采集:运用治疗性沟通技巧,按照交谈提纲收集患者一般资料、现病史、既往史、用药史、过敏史、家族史、社会心理史、生活方式等主观资料,注意保护患者隐私
• 实施身体评估:按照视诊、触诊、叩诊、听诊、嗅诊的顺序,从头到脚进行系统身体检查,测量生命体征(体温、脉搏、呼吸、血压、血氧饱和度),检查各系统的阳性体征,记录所有异常发现
• 收集客观资料:查阅病历获取实验室检查结果(血常规、血生化、尿常规等)、影像检查结果(X线、CT、超声等)、心电图等,使用评估量表进行风险评估(Braden评分、Morse跌倒评分、NRS疼痛评分)
产出:完整护理评估单、身体评估记录表、实验室/影像检查结果汇总表、风险评估量表评分结果| 质量标准:评估资料完整准确,身体评估操作规范,异常发现识别全面,记录及时清晰
步骤 3
护理诊断确立与护理计划制定
本步骤的核心任务是运用评判性思维分析评估资料,确立护理诊断,并制定完整的护理计划。护理诊断需要遵循NANDA-I的标准化术语,包括问题、相关因素和诊断依据。护理计划需要设定明确的预期目标和具体的护理措施,体现个性化、优先级和循证依据。这一步是护理程序的决策环节。

• 整理分析评估资料:将主观和客观资料分类整理,运用MASLOW需要层次理论排序健康问题,识别异常数据和风险因素,找出有意义的护理线索,形成推断和假设
• 确立护理诊断:按照NANDA-I诊断分类系统,列出至少5个护理诊断,每个诊断包含名称、定义、诊断依据(主观+客观)、相关因素或危险因素,按首优、中优、次优排序
• 制定护理计划:为每个护理诊断设定短期和长期目标(SMART原则:具体、可测量、可达到、相关、有时限),制定具体护理措施(病情观察、基础护理、治疗配合、健康教育、心理护理),注明措施的依据和频率
产出:护理诊断列表(含诊断依据和相关因素)、护理计划表(含目标、措施、依据、评价时间)、护理诊断排序依据说明| 质量标准:护理诊断准确规范,问题排序合理,目标具体可测,措施详实有依据
步骤 4
护理措施实施与效果评价
本步骤的核心任务是按照护理计划实施护理措施,并系统评价护理效果。护理实施需要熟练的操作技能、良好的沟通能力和敏锐的观察力,在实施过程中持续评估患者反应并及时调整。效果评价需要将实际结果与预期目标进行对比,判断目标达成情况,决定护理计划的修改、继续或终止。

• 实施护理措施:按照护理计划执行各项护理操作(如生命体征监测、用药护理、伤口护理、饮食护理、排泄护理、体位护理、健康教育、心理护理),严格执行查对制度和无菌操作原则,记录执行时间和患者反应
• 动态观察与记录:使用护理记录单(PIO格式:问题-措施-评价)进行动态记录,每班评估患者病情变化,观察治疗效果和不良反应,及时发现新的护理问题,调整护理措施
• 护理效果评价:在设定的评价时间点,将患者实际健康状况与预期目标进行比较,判断目标完全实现、部分实现还是未实现,分析未实现的原因,修订护理计划,必要时重新评估
产出:护理执行记录单(PIO记录)、护理效果评价表、修订后的护理计划、护理小结| 质量标准:护理措施落实到位,操作规范,记录及时准确,效果评价客观全面
步骤 5
护理病历撰写与整体护理总结
本步骤的核心任务是整理所有护理资料,撰写完整、规范的护理病历,总结整体护理过程并进行反思。护理病历是具有法律效力的正式文件,需要书写规范、内容客观、描述准确、逻辑清晰。整体护理总结体现了对护理程序的系统理解和应用能力,以及在实践中的反思与成长。

• 撰写完整护理病历:按照护理文书书写规范,整理护理评估单、护理诊断/问题项目表、护理计划单、护理记录单、健康教育单、出院指导单等,形成完整的护理病历,确保术语规范、字迹清晰、数据准确
• 整体护理总结:系统回顾整个护理过程,总结护理程序各阶段的应用体会,分析护理措施的有效性,讨论护理中的难点和不足,提出改进措施,体现循证护理思维
• 病例汇报准备:制作病例汇报PPT,包含病例介绍、护理评估、护理诊断、护理计划、护理措施、效果评价、护理体会等部分,准备10分钟的口头汇报,能够回答提问
产出:完整护理病历(全套护理文书)、整体护理总结报告、病例汇报PPT| 质量标准:护理病历完整规范,总结反思深入有见解,汇报清晰专业,体现整体护理理念

Steps

Step 1
Case Selection and Nursing Assessment Framework Design
The core task of this step is to select a representative clinical case and design a systematic nursing assessment framework. The case should cover multiple body systems and demonstrate complete application of the nursing process.

• Select typical case: choose a case with multiple nursing problems from internal medicine, surgery, geriatrics, or community nursing (elderly hypertensive patient with diabetes, postoperative recovery patient, COPD patient); obtain complete history and examination data
• Design nursing assessment framework: based on Gordon's Functional Health Patterns or NANDA framework, design assessment covering 11 functional domains including general data, present illness, past history, physical assessment, psychosocial assessment, laboratory tests
• Develop assessment plan: determine assessment methods (interview, observation, physical examination, chart review), assessment tools (scales: pain scale, anxiety scale, pressure ulcer risk, fall risk), and assessment timeline
Deliverable: Case summary, nursing assessment framework table, assessment tool list, assessment implementation plan | Quality standard: Typical and appropriately complex case, systematic and comprehensive assessment framework, scientific and reasonable tool selection
Step 2
Systematic Nursing Assessment and Data Collection
The core task of this step is to conduct systematic and comprehensive nursing assessment according to the framework, collecting both subjective and objective data. It requires communication skills, physical assessment skills, and critical thinking.

• Conduct nursing interview and health history collection: use therapeutic communication skills; collect subjective data including general data, present illness, past history, medication history, allergies, family history, psychosocial history, lifestyle; protect patient privacy
• Perform physical assessment: following inspection, palpation, percussion, auscultation, olfaction order; conduct head-to-toe systematic examination; measure vital signs (temperature, pulse, respiration, blood pressure, SpO2); identify positive signs in each system; document all abnormal findings
• Collect objective data: review medical records for laboratory results (CBC, blood chemistry, urinalysis), imaging results (X-ray, CT, ultrasound), ECG; perform risk assessments using scales (Braden score, Morse Fall Scale, NRS pain score)
Deliverable: Complete nursing assessment form, physical assessment record, laboratory/imaging results summary, risk assessment scale scores | Quality standard: Complete and accurate assessment data, standardized physical examination, comprehensive abnormal finding identification, timely and clear documentation
Step 3
Nursing Diagnosis Establishment and Care Planning
The core task of this step is to analyze assessment data using critical thinking, establish nursing diagnoses, and develop a comprehensive care plan. Nursing diagnoses should follow NANDA-I standardized terminology including problem, etiology, and defining characteristics.

• Organize and analyze assessment data: categorize subjective and objective data; prioritize health problems using Maslow's hierarchy; identify abnormal data and risk factors; find meaningful nursing cues; form inferences and hypotheses
• Establish nursing diagnoses: following NANDA-I classification system, list at least 5 nursing diagnoses; each includes name, definition, defining characteristics (subjective + objective), related factors or risk factors; prioritize by high/medium/low priority
• Develop care plan: set short-term and long-term goals for each diagnosis (SMART: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, Time-bound); formulate specific nursing interventions (observation, basic care, treatment collaboration, health education, psychological care); note rationale and frequency
Deliverable: Nursing diagnosis list (with defining characteristics and related factors), care plan table (goals, interventions, rationale, evaluation time), diagnosis prioritization rationale | Quality standard: Accurate and standardized nursing diagnoses, reasonable prioritization, specific and measurable goals, detailed and evidence-based interventions
Step 4
Nursing Intervention Implementation and Outcome Evaluation
The core task of this step is to implement nursing interventions according to the care plan and systematically evaluate nursing outcomes. Implementation requires technical skills, communication ability, and keen observation, with continuous reassessment and adjustment.

• Implement nursing interventions: execute nursing procedures according to care plan (vital sign monitoring, medication administration, wound care, dietary care, elimination care, positioning, health education, psychological care); strictly follow verification system and aseptic technique; record execution time and patient response
• Dynamic observation and documentation: use PIO format (Problem-Intervention-Outcome) for dynamic recording; assess patient condition change each shift; observe treatment effects and adverse reactions; promptly identify new nursing problems; adjust interventions
• Nursing outcome evaluation: at designated evaluation time points, compare actual patient health status with expected goals; determine if goals are fully met, partially met, or unmet; analyze reasons for unmet goals; revise care plan; reassess if necessary
Deliverable: Nursing implementation records (PIO notes), nursing outcome evaluation form, revised care plan, nursing summary | Quality standard: Nursing interventions fully implemented, standardized operations, timely and accurate documentation, objective and comprehensive outcome evaluation
Step 5
Nursing Record Writing and Holistic Nursing Summary
The core task of this step is to organize all nursing data, write a complete and standardized nursing record, and summarize the holistic nursing process with reflection. Nursing records are legally binding formal documents requiring standardized writing and objective content.

• Write complete nursing record: following nursing documentation standards, organize assessment forms, nursing diagnosis/problem list, care plan, nursing notes, health education records, discharge instructions; ensure standardized terminology, clear writing, accurate data
• Holistic nursing summary: systematically review the entire nursing process; summarize application experience of each nursing phase; analyze effectiveness of interventions; discuss difficulties and shortcomings; propose improvement measures; demonstrate evidence-based nursing thinking
• Case presentation preparation: create case presentation PPT including case introduction, nursing assessment, nursing diagnoses, care plan, interventions, outcome evaluation, nursing reflections; prepare 10-minute oral presentation with ability to answer questions
Deliverable: Complete nursing record (full set of nursing documents), holistic nursing summary report, case presentation PPT | Quality standard: Complete and standardized nursing record, in-depth reflection with insights, clear and professional presentation, holistic nursing philosophy demonstrated
